开发者社区 > 大数据与机器学习 > 实时计算 Flink > 正文

Flink CDC如何评估运行任务与资源需求的关系呀?

Flink CDC如何评估运行任务与资源需求的关系呀?

展开
收起
cuicuicuic 2023-12-04 08:09:26 58 0
3 条回答
写回答
取消 提交回答
  • 评估 Flink CDC 运行任务与资源需求的关系可以帮助您优化任务性能和资源利用。以下是一些常见的方法和指导:

    1. 监控任务指标:通过监控任务的关键指标,如吞吐量、延迟、状态大小等,可以了解任务的运行情况和性能表现。这些指标可以帮助确定任务是否需要更多资源来提高性能,或者是否可以调整资源配置以节省成本。

    2. 资源配置参数:Flink 提供了一些重要的资源配置参数,例如并行度、内存分配、网络缓冲区大小等。根据任务的特点和数据量,合理设置这些参数是非常重要的。尝试不同的配置选项,并观察任务的性能变化,以找到最佳的资源配置。

    3. 压测和基准测试:使用压力测试工具或模拟负载的方式,对任务进行基准测试。通过逐渐增加负载并监控任务的性能,可以评估任务在不同资源条件下的表现,并找到性能瓶颈和资源需求的关系。

    4. 容量规划:根据任务的需求和预期的数据量,进行容量规划。考虑任务的并行度、数据处理速率、数据大小等因素,结合集群的可用资源来估算所需的资源量。这可以帮助您预先分配适当的资源,避免资源瓶颈和性能问题。

    5. 动态调整:在运行时,根据任务的实际负载情况动态调整资源配置。Flink 提供了一些动态调整资源的功能,如动态缩放并行度、动态修改内存分配等。根据任务的负载情况和性能需求,动态调整资源配置可以使任务更高效地利用资源。

    2023-12-04 20:51:11
    赞同 展开评论 打赏
  • 面对过去,不要迷离;面对未来,不必彷徨;活在今天,你只要把自己完全展示给别人看。

    评估Flink CDC任务与资源需求的关系,主要需要关注以下几个方面:

    1. 内存资源:Flink作业的内存主要分为堆内内存和堆外内存。堆内内存主要包括Framework Heap Memory、Task Heap Memory,而堆外内存则包括Managed Memory、Framework Off-heap Memory、Network等部分。你可以使用指标数据来获取当前资源的使用情况,以便进行精细化调整。

    2. CPU资源:Flink作业的运行也需要大量的CPU计算能力。如果发现CPU使用率过高,可能需要调整Flink作业的配置以提高性能。

    3. 磁盘存储资源:Flink作业可能会使用到本地磁盘或者依赖的外部存储资源(如HDFS、S3等)来保存任务状态和数据。这部分资源一般不是瓶颈,但也需要确保有足够的存储空间。

    4. 网络资源:Flink作业的网络资源主要用于任务间的数据交换和通信。良好的网络环境可以有效提高作业的运行效率。

    2023-12-04 14:07:36
    赞同 展开评论 打赏
  • 在Flink CDC中,评估运行任务与资源需求的关系主要涉及到以下几个方面:

    1. 数据规模:Flink任务需要的CPU和内存与数据规模成正比。如果数据规模较大,那么任务需要更多的CPU和内存来处理数据。

    2. 并行度:Flink任务的并行度越高,需要的CPU和内存就越多。通过调整并行度,您可以控制Flink使用多少资源来处理任务。

    3. 其他因素:除了数据和并行度外,还有其他一些因素可能影响资源需求,如任务的处理逻辑、数据的复杂度等。

    在实际使用中,可以通过以下步骤来评估运行任务与资源需求的关系:

    1. 分析任务处理的数据规模和复杂性,以确定所需的CPU和内存资源。

    2. 设置合适的并行度,以控制资源的使用。

    3. 监控任务的资源使用情况,以确保资源得到有效的利用。如果发现资源使用过多或过少,可以通过调整并行度或其他参数来优化资源使用。

    总的来说,评估运行任务与资源需求的关系需要根据实际任务和数据情况进行,可能需要多次调整和优化才能达到最佳的效果。

    2023-12-04 11:45:42
    赞同 展开评论 打赏

实时计算Flink版是阿里云提供的全托管Serverless Flink云服务,基于 Apache Flink 构建的企业级、高性能实时大数据处理系统。提供全托管版 Flink 集群和引擎,提高作业开发运维效率。

相关产品

  • 实时计算 Flink版
  • 相关电子书

    更多
    Flink CDC Meetup PPT - 龚中强 立即下载
    Flink CDC Meetup PPT - 王赫 立即下载
    Flink CDC Meetup PPT - 覃立辉 立即下载